I t's possible that your jaws are misaligned, even if your teeth appear to be straight. In this scenario, a Tatum Orthodontist may recommend treatment to prevent future issues like premature tooth loss, excessive wear on tooth enamel, speech and chewing difficulties, and more serious jaw disorders. A jaw or dental alignment problem can be hereditary or induced by an injury, the premature or late loss of an infant's teeth, or thumb sucking. Treatment and regulation of many aspects of facial growth, as well as the shape and development of the jaw, are also included in orthodontics.
